BoJack Horseman. I felt the characters were relatable and progressed nicely with the series. There was plenty of solid humor (some dark humor too) mixed in-between some also very relatable themes like struggles with mental challenges, substance abuse, and the general rat-race of life and society at large. Definitely for "mature audiences".

    Love, Death, and Robots is probably my all-time favorite show. I absolutely love it. Each episode has a different plot, characters, setting, and animation style. It's very gory, though, just FYI
